Salary and Benefits
- Starting Salary £26,500, with £1,000 increase with each year of service up to £30,500.
- An in‑depth training programme including classroom sessions, shadowing, training manuals and short videos.
- Enrolment into a company pension plan with a generous employer contribution.
- A convenient office base a few minutes’ walk from Birmingham International train station.
- Free onsite car parking.
- Free breakfast, hot and cold drinks.
- Discounted gym membership.
- Holiday entitlement that increases with length of service.
Responsibilities
- Answer inbound calls from existing customers.
- Take ownership of customer problems, solve at first point of contact and escalate when required.
- Use a range of techniques to engage and build relationships quickly, often with vulnerable customers.
- Develop and maintain a good understanding of systems and processes to ensure accurate recording of customer queries.
- Advise customers in line with industry regulations.
Skills and Experience Required
- IT literate.
- Experience in CRM desirable.
- Good communication and listening skills.
- Professional and friendly approach to work.
- Adaptable to change.
- Ability to work in a fast‑paced environment.
Schedule: Monday – Friday shift patterns between 08.00 – 19.00.

How to prepare for a job interview at E
✨Know the Role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the responsibilities of a Call Centre Associate. Familiarise yourself with handling customer queries, problem-solving techniques, and the importance of building relationships with customers.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Practice Your Communication Skills
Since good communication is key for this position,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and concisely. You might want to do mock interviews with friends or family, focusing on how you would handle specific customer scenarios. This will help you demonstrate your professional and friendly approach during the actual interview.
✨Show Your Adaptability
The job requires adaptability to change, so be prepared to discuss times when you've successfully navigated changes in a fast-paced environment. Think of examples where you’ve had to adjust quickly and how you managed those situations. This will highlight your ability to thrive under pressure.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the training programme, team dynamics, or how success is measured in the role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if the company culture aligns with your values.
